Sick (1961) #74Published Mar 1970 by Charlton Comics Group.
This item is not in stock at MyComicShop. If you use the "Add to want list" tab to add this issue to your want list, we will email you when it becomes available.
Cover by Jerry Grandenetti. Stories and art by Phyllis Diller, Bernard Wiseman, John Dromey, Al Kaufman, Bill Majeski, Art Paul, Bob Taylor, Bill Robinson, Don Orehek, Jack Sparling, and Fred Wolfe. Sometimes listed as Vol. 10 No. 2. One of the more successful MAD mimics, created by comics legend Joe Simon, featuring an array of comedic talent. Sick presents an excerpt from the book The Complete Mother by famed comedian Phyllis Diller. A Sick look at the groundbreaking TV series Julia. A parody of the movie classic Easy Rider. A spoof of the paranomal TV sitcom The Ghost and Mrs. Muir. The superhero parody on the cover features political figures and celebrities from the news in 1970s, including Cassius Clay, later known as Muhammad Ali. Sick Signs; Lincoln's Birthday; Things to Worry about in Vietnam; Sleazy Rider; I Never Met a Baby-Sitter I Didn't Like; The Ghost and Mrs. Bore; Supermouth; History Lesson; Sick on the Picket Line; Party Game; Student Unrest; War Movies. 8 1/2-in. x 11-in., 48 pages, B&W. Cover price $0.35.

1st printing. Stories and Art by Greg Irons, Dave Sheridan, Jack Jackson, Fred Schrier, and Rory Hayes. Classic Underground Horror/Humor comic inspired by classic EC Comic Tales. 7-in. x 10 1/4-in., 36 pages, B&W, MATURE READERS NOTE: Printing Very Difficult to determine. 1st and 2nd Printings have a printing defect on Story Page 7 of the story "The Answer" in which the word "Decadence" is partially covered. This is Corrected in the 3rd Printings. Further, 1st Printings are slightly taller than 2nd printings, and the art on issue pages 20-29 is tilted due to incorrect printing alignment of 1st Printings. Cover price $0.50.

"The Voodoo Planet," script by Dick Wood, art by Alberto Giolitti; Kirk and Spock beam down to an exact replica of Earth; How did it come to be... and why? 36 pgs., full color. $0.15. The Whitman Star Trek editions are not reprints. The Gold Key and Whitman editions were released simultaneously, but through different distribution channels. Cover price $0.15.

Cover pencils by Marie Severin, inks by Mike Esposito. First appearance of Orka in "The Coming of Orka," script by Roy Thomas, pencils by Marie Severin, inks by Johnny Craig; Returning to his undersea realm, Namor comes across a large herd of killer whales, led by the monstrous Orka, and takes him on; Namor is defeated by Orka, but follows him and discovers that Dr. Dorcas and Krang are actually behind Orka's powers, and are planning an attack on Atlantis; Namor gains the upper hand by threatening Krang's life which prompts Orka to turn against Dorcas; However, Namor's plan comes undone and he's taken down hard by Orka; Following Krang's orders, Orka puts a stun-collar and chains on the Sub-Mariner; Krang then announces an intention of marching into Atlantis with an enslaved Namor. 36 pgs., full color. $0.15. Cover price $0.15.
